Why is highly bioavailable iron important?
Iron is the most common trace element in the body. Total body iron is approximately 5 g. Iron is equally important for body chemistry and thus for well-being. It regulates numerous enzymes and proteins that are very important:
- Tyrosine hydroxylase (dopamine, noradrenaline and adrenaline synthesis)
- Tryptophan hydroxylase (serotonin and melatonin formation)
- Nitric oxide synthase (synthesis of NO)
- Lipoxygenase (immune system)
- Cytochrome P450 (liver detoxification, synthesis of sex hormones)
- Peroxidases, catalases (antioxidants)
- Iron-containing proteins of the mitochondria (energy production)
Iron is the crucial central atom of all those proteins that work with oxygen, including haemoglobin (blood) and myoglobin (oxygen storage in cells). Furthermore, iron also regulates the formation of collagen (collagen hydroxylases), the most important structural protein of the body.
At the same time, iron absorption from food is inhibited in multiple ways. Possible influences include:
- Phytic acid in cereals, nuts and the like
- Dietary fibres
- Oxalates in many vegetables
- Polyphenols, for example from coffee
- Many medications
- Higher amounts of certain other metals, for example zinc
- Low protein intake

- In our iron capsules, iron is present in the form of iron glycinate as a chelate complex with glycine. Studies suggest that iron is better absorbed when it can form a stable complex. This succeeds with divalent ions such as iron, for example with amino acids such as glycine. It is speculated that iron bound to amino acids is then more likely to be absorbed intact via the amino acid transporter. Therefore, dietary proteins also have a positive influence on iron absorption and potential inhibitory effects from food are better compensated. For example, a study with newborns concludes:
The higher bioavailability of iron bisglycinate chelate resulted in a lower burden of elemental iron, a quarter of the dose, and achieved equivalent efficacy compared to iron sulphate. Iron bisglycinate chelate appears to be an alternative to iron sulphate in the prevention and treatment of anaemia in premature infants.
To our iron capsules, we also add lactoferrin. This is a protein that naturally occurs in the milk of many mammals, including humans. It is also found in many body secretions and acts antimicrobially there.
Taking lactoferrin with iron: This is the advantage
For years, lactoferrin has had the reputation of being an ideal absorption accelerator, because one of the main roles of lactoferrin is to bind iron and transport it to cells. For this reason, there is a lactoferrin receptor in the intestine. For example, only in 2020 could a study show that the addition of lactoferrin to a conventional iron compound (iron sulphate) improved absorption by more than 50 %.
- An often neglected factor is vitamin C. As a source of vitamin C, we use the acerola cherry. Even small amounts of vitamin C, between 50 and 100 mg, can dramatically improve iron absorption – by approximately 50 % to 400 %. The effect of vitamin C appears to be linear, that is, even larger doses can additionally increase the effects.
